Kevin Clifton hints at Strictly Come Dancing return

Kevin quit the show earlier this year

Author: Alex RossPublished 21st Jul 2020

He'd been on the show for a massive seven years, with various successes throughout, so it's no surprise fans of Strictly Come Dancing were gutted earlier this year when professional dancer Kevin Clifton announced he was leaving.

Back in March, just a few weeks before the world went into lockdown, Kevin broke the news to fans that he'd quit the popular BBC show, writing on social media, 'To the entire Strictly family, The past 7 years have been some of the most wonderful years of my life. I am grateful to the BBC and Strictly Come Dancing for giving me the opportunity to have been a part of something truly special.'

He added, 'Since first being called ‘Kevin From Grimsby’ by Sir Bruce Forsyth in 2013 I have experienced the highs of 5 finals, winning a Guinness World record on It Takes Two, the Strictly Arena tour glitterball and then the ultimate of winning the 2018 series with Stacey Dooley. After finishing last series with the Children In Need trophy and the Christmas Special I want to leave on a high and have therefore decided the time has come to move on and focus on other areas of my life and career.

'I want to thank all of the pros for inspiring me every day as well as all of my celebrity partners. The whole team behind the scenes have made always made the Strictly family what it is and the loveliest show to work for.

'Thank you to anyone who has ever voted for me and my partners. It means the world. And a special thank you to Jason Gilkison for always believing in me.'

Kevin then ended his message, saying, 'To me Strictly always has been and always will be the best show on tv and has been an absolute dream and honour to be a part of. Pre 2013 I used to watch every week. Now I look forward to returning to being a fan and cheering on my friends who keep dancing.' (sic)

However, with most of his post-Strictly plans now ruined due to the Coronavirus, Kevin has hinted he could make a return to the show in the near future!

Speaking to The Guardian, Kevin said, "I can't leave my sister high and dry, and go back on Strictly but I don't know. Never say never.

"I've made that decision (to leave Strictly) and it would feel weird if I suddenly went back again."

Despite a lot of our favourite TV shows like Line of Duty, Love Island and The Apprentice all being postponed or cancelled due to the Coronavirus pandemic, bosses are hopeful that the 2020 series of Strictly Come Dancing will go ahead.

Whilst head judge Shirley Ballas has said she thinks the show will go ahead, bosses are also hopeful, with the BBC's Dan McGolpin telling BBC Essex, "It wouldn't be the same if we didn't have Strictly in the autumn, would it? So no of course the BBC is doing everything it can, and I know that everyone involved in that production team would absolutely love that to happen this Autumn."

He added, "So we've really just got to keep watching the government advice, thinking about what's possible."
